Decluttering Tips for a Successful Cleanout

Decluttering doesn’t have to feel overwhelming! Here are some effective strategies to make the process smoother:

  • Start small: Tackle one area at a time, like a coffee table or a corner of the room.
  • Use the one-year rule: If you haven’t used an item in the past year, consider letting it go.
  • Sort items into categories: Keep, donate, recycle, or toss. This helps clarify what you truly need.

FAQs on Living Room Cleanout and Organization

To help clarify the process further, here are some common questions regarding living room cleanouts:

  • How often should I declutter my living room? Aim for a deep clean at least once a season, with quick tidy-ups weekly.
  • What should I do with items I no longer need? Donate, recycle, or sell them—just ensure they find a new home.
  • Can I involve my kids in decluttering? Absolutely! It’s a great way to teach them about organization.
  • What if I feel overwhelmed by clutter? Start small! Tackle one area at a time and celebrate your progress.
